In order to tryout, players must have been cleared through the gold card process.
Please bring your own personal water bottle and fill them up before the workouts. Also, please be prepared with warm-up clothes, including running shoes, for each ice hockey workout.
Players are expected to be present at all tryout sessions. Missing sessions will be incorporated into the coach's evaluation of players for the Varsity team.
Tryouts consist of assessments of individual ice hockey skills. Players will be evaluated on conditioning, stick skills, skating effort and attitude.
The coaching staff also tests the athletes for general athleticism.
Players are also evaluated on their cooperation with other players and their ability to take direction from the coaching staff.
Ice Hockey is a commitment of about 1.5-2 hours per day, 6 days a week with occasional Saturday games and competitions. It is our expectation that athletes will be present for all team tryouts, scrimmages, practices, games, and tournaments.
The regular season ends in March for both teams.
